When Jamal drops the question "Y Not" in his latest visual offering, it's more than just a rhetorical inquiry—it's a full-blown declaration of intent that cuts through the dancehall scene like a machete through sugar cane. From the opening bars, this track demonstrates why the artist continues to command respect in a genre where authenticity separates the real ones from the wannabes. The production rides a contemporary riddim that pays homage to the classic dancehall blueprint while injecting enough modern flavor to keep the younger generation locked in. Jamal's flow switches between the melodic singjay style that made dancehall global and those hard-hitting deejay bars that remind you this music was born in the concrete jungles of Kingston. The visual treatment elevates the track's raw energy, capturing that genuine yard vibes that can't be manufactured in no studio boardroom. Jamal's delivery is pure fire—his vocal presence commanding every frame while the riddim provides the perfect foundation for his lyrical acrobatics. The cultural authenticity bleeds through every second, from the street credibility in his bars to the way he rides the pocket of the beat like he was born to do it. This isn't just another dancehall track trying to chase trends; it's a statement piece that shows Jamal understands the assignment when it comes to carrying the culture forward. The energy is infectious, the production is crisp, and the overall package feels like essential viewing for anyone who claims to love this music. When the dust settles and the sound system powers down, "Y Not" stands as proof that real recognize real in this dancehall game.
